# 防火墙策略未合理分类导致策略混乱:AI技术的应用与解决方案
## 引言
在现代网络安全体系中,防火墙作为第一道防线,其策略的合理配置与管理至关重要。然而,许多企业在防火墙策略管理上存在诸多问题,尤其是策略未合理分类导致的策略混乱,这不仅降低了网络安全性,还增加了管理难度。本文将深入分析这一问题,并探讨如何利用AI技术进行优化和解决。
## 一、防火墙策略混乱的现状与危害
### 1.1 策略混乱的现状
防火墙策略混乱主要表现为以下几个方面:
- **策略数量庞大**:随着网络规模的扩大,防火墙策略数量急剧增加,难以手动管理。
- **分类不明确**:策略缺乏明确的分类标准,导致相似或重复的策略混杂在一起。
- **更新不及时**:旧策略未及时清理,新策略又不断添加,导致策略库臃肿不堪。
### 1.2 策略混乱的危害
策略混乱带来的危害是多方面的:
- **安全漏洞**:混乱的策略可能导致安全漏洞,给攻击者可乘之机。
- **性能下降**:过多的无效策略会增加防火墙的负担,影响网络性能。
- **管理困难**:策略混乱使得管理员难以快速定位和解决问题,增加了管理难度。
## 二、AI技术在防火墙策略管理中的应用
### 2.1 AI技术的优势
AI技术在防火墙策略管理中具有以下优势:
- **自动化处理**:AI可以自动分析和处理大量数据,提高管理效率。
- **智能分类**:通过机器学习算法,AI可以对策略进行智能分类,减少人为错误。
- **实时监控**:AI可以实时监控网络流量和策略执行情况,及时发现和解决问题。
### 2.2 应用场景
#### 2.2.1 策略智能分类
利用自然语言处理(NLP)和聚类算法,AI可以对防火墙策略进行智能分类。具体步骤如下:
1. **数据预处理**:提取策略描述中的关键词,进行文本向量化。
2. **聚类分析**:使用K-means等聚类算法,将相似策略归为一类。
3. **标签生成**:根据聚类结果,自动生成分类标签,便于后续管理。
#### 2.2.2 策略优化建议
通过机器学习模型,AI可以分析历史数据和当前网络环境,提出策略优化建议:
1. **数据收集**:收集网络流量、攻击日志等数据。
2. **模型训练**:使用决策树、随机森林等算法,训练策略优化模型。
3. **建议生成**:根据模型预测结果,生成策略优化建议,如删除无效策略、合并相似策略等。
#### 2.2.3 实时监控与告警
AI可以实时监控防火墙策略的执行情况,及时发现异常并发出告警:
1. **流量分析**:实时分析网络流量,识别异常行为。
2. **策略匹配**:检查流量是否符合当前策略,发现违规行为。
3. **告警机制**:一旦发现异常,立即发出告警,通知管理员进行处理。
## 三、基于AI的防火墙策略管理解决方案
### 3.1 策略分类与清理
#### 3.1.1 智能分类工具
开发一款基于AI的智能分类工具,实现对防火墙策略的自动分类:
- **功能模块**:包括数据预处理、聚类分析、标签生成等模块。
- **用户界面**:提供友好的用户界面,方便管理员查看和调整分类结果。
#### 3.1.2 策略清理流程
制定一套基于AI的策略清理流程,定期清理无效和冗余策略:
1. **数据收集**:收集策略使用情况和网络流量数据。
2. **模型分析**:使用AI模型分析策略的有效性。
3. **清理建议**:生成清理建议,由管理员确认后执行。
### 3.2 策略优化与更新
#### 3.2.1 优化建议系统
构建一个基于AI的策略优化建议系统,提供实时的优化建议:
- **数据来源**:整合网络流量、攻击日志、策略执行情况等多源数据。
- **模型选择**:选择适合的机器学习算法,如随机森林、神经网络等。
- **建议输出**:生成具体的优化建议,如策略调整、新增策略等。
#### 3.2.2 自动更新机制
建立一套自动更新机制,确保防火墙策略的及时更新:
1. **实时监控**:AI系统实时监控网络环境和策略执行情况。
2. **动态调整**:根据监控结果,动态调整策略配置。
3. **审批流程**:调整后的策略需经过管理员审批后生效。
### 3.3 实时监控与告警
#### 3.3.1 监控系统架构
设计一个基于AI的实时监控系统架构:
- **数据采集层**:负责收集网络流量、策略执行日志等数据。
- **数据分析层**:使用AI算法对数据进行实时分析。
- **告警管理层**:根据分析结果,生成告警信息,通知管理员。
#### 3.3.2 告警机制优化
优化告警机制,减少误报和漏报:
1. **阈值设置**:根据历史数据,设置合理的告警阈值。
2. **多维度分析**:结合多个维度的数据进行分析,提高告警准确性。
3. **智能过滤**:使用AI算法过滤掉无效告警,减少管理员负担。
## 四、实施步骤与注意事项
### 4.1 实施步骤
1. **需求分析**:明确防火墙策略管理的具体需求。
2. **技术选型**:选择合适的AI技术和工具。
3. **系统开发**:开发基于AI的防火墙策略管理系统。
4. **测试验证**:进行系统测试,验证其功能和性能。
5. **部署上线**:将系统部署到实际环境中,进行试运行。
6. **持续优化**:根据运行情况,持续优化系统功能和性能。
### 4.2 注意事项
1. **数据安全**:确保在数据收集和处理过程中,保护用户隐私和数据安全。
2. **模型准确性**:定期评估AI模型的准确性,及时进行调整和优化。
3. **人工干预**:在关键环节保留人工干预机制,防止AI决策失误。
4. **培训与支持**:对管理员进行系统培训,提供技术支持,确保系统顺利运行。
## 五、结论
防火墙策略未合理分类导致的策略混乱,是当前网络安全管理中的一个重要问题。通过引入AI技术,可以实现策略的智能分类、优化和实时监控,有效解决这一问题。本文提出的基于AI的防火墙策略管理解决方案,不仅提高了管理效率和安全性,还为未来的网络安全管理提供了新的思路和方法。
随着AI技术的不断发展和应用,相信在不久的将来,防火墙策略管理将变得更加智能化和高效,为企业的网络安全提供更加坚实的保障。